Handover: SweepEngine, our data-retention sweeper. It runs nightly, deleting records past policy age across the Kestrelbay clusters. Known issues: the archive step occasionally stalls on large partitions — restart the worker, don't re-trigger the sweep. Support tickets about "missing old records" are almost always expected retention behaviour; check the policy table before escalating. Dry-run mode is safe and logs what would be deleted. Runbook, policy table, and escalation criteria are all on the internal support page.

runbook for tafof-yawif: https://confluence.tolvaqsys.internal/display/display/browse/pages/7be3

Step 4: Publish the renderer bundle. After the Inkmill markdown pipeline passes the fixture suite, build the production bundle and generate the manifest. The CDN at Bramwick Hosting rejects any manifest lacking a valid signature, so signing is not optional. Confirm the version string matches the changelog entry before signing. Sign the manifest with the deploy key shown below.

rollout seal: bky3_Zik

## Releases

Upgrading the Burrowpipe message broker? Good news: 3.x nodes can run mixed with 2.9 during rollout, so no big-bang migration needed. Support folks, the usual complaint is stuck consumers after the restart — just tell users to reconnect, the client library handles the rest. Grab the tarball from the releases page and verify it before handing it to anyone. Each release is signed, and you can check the signature against the key below.

deploy key for kajof-fajop: bky6_gDHw9Q

TURN-208: Gatevale turnstile counters at the Merrow Field pilot double-count when a rotation reverses mid-cycle. Attendance totals drift roughly 2% high per event. The debounce window fix is implemented, reviewed by Ilsa, and soak-tested across two simulated match days without drift. Ready for your cut; the candidate build is identified below.

trace token, tagag-tafog: htk6_5ed18c